    About Amelyne

    Amelyne offers a captivating blend of elegant classicism and modern uniqueness, perfect for parents who appreciate a name with deep roots but prefer to sidestep the well-trodden path. Stemming from Old Germanic elements signifying "work" or "industriousness," it carries an inherent strength and purpose. While its sound echoes the familiarity of Amelia or Emily, Amelyne stands distinctively apart, a rare gem that feels both timeless and refreshingly new. This name suits a family looking for a sophisticated choice that will grow beautifully with their child, offering a subtle nod to tradition without sacrificing individuality.
